MetaMask(メタマスク)のアドレス変更はできる?その理由と方法




MetaMask(メタマスク)のアドレス変更はできる?その理由と方法


MetaMask(メタマスク)のアドレス変更はできる?その理由と方法

はじめに:なぜ「アドレス変更」が気になるのか

近年、ブロックチェーン技術とデジタル資産の普及が進む中、仮想通貨やNFT(非代替性トークン)の取引・管理を目的として、さまざまなウォレットアプリが登場しています。その中でも特に広く利用されているのが、MetaMaskです。このプラットフォームは、ユーザーが簡単にイーサリアム(Ethereum)ネットワーク上のトランザクションを実行できることから、多くの開発者や一般ユーザーに支持されています。

しかし、こうした利用者がよく抱く疑問の一つが、「MetaMaskのアドレスを変更することは可能か?」という点です。ここでは、この質問に正面から向き合い、技術的背景、理論的な制約、現実的な対応策を丁寧に解説します。本記事では、あくまで公式仕様およびセキュリティ基準に基づいた内容を提示し、誤解を招くような表現は一切避けます。

MetaMaskとは何か?アドレスの基本構造

MetaMaskは、ウェブブラウザ上で動作するソフトウェアウォレットであり、ユーザーの暗号資産(主にイーサリアムやそのトークン)を安全に管理するためのツールです。重要なのは、MetaMask自体は「アドレスの所有権を保有しているわけではないということです。アドレスは、ユーザーの秘密鍵(Private Key)によって生成され、その鍵が存在する限り、そのアドレスへのアクセス権限も維持されます。

各アドレスは、64文字のハッシュ値(例:0x742d35Cc6634C0532925a3b8D4C2587F2A4B5862)で表され、これは公開鍵(Public Key)から導出されるもので、一意かつ再生成不可能な特徴を持っています。つまり、アドレスは物理的な「個人識別番号」とも言える存在であり、一度生成されたら、改ざんや変更は原則として不可能です。

なぜアドレス変更は技術的に不可能なのか?

まず明確にしておくべきことは、MetaMaskのアドレス変更機能は、設計上存在しないということです。以下にその理由を三つに分けて説明します。

1. ブロックチェーンの不可逆性とアドレスの一意性

ブロックチェーン技術の根本原理である「不可逆性(Immutability)」は、過去の取引データが改ざんできないことを意味します。同様に、アドレスも一度生成されたら、それ以降の追加・削除・変更はできません。これは、ネットワーク全体の信頼性を確保するための設計です。もしアドレス変更が可能になれば、取引履歴の整合性が損なわれ、悪意あるユーザーによる偽装や二重支払いのリスクが高まります。

2. 秘密鍵とアドレスの関係

アドレスは、秘密鍵から生成される数学的な結果です。具体的には、楕円曲線暗号方式(ECDSA)を用いて、秘密鍵から公開鍵を導出し、さらにハッシュ処理を経てアドレスが決定されます。このプロセスは、単方向性(One-way Function)を持つため、アドレスから秘密鍵を逆算することは極めて困難です(現実的には不可能)。逆に言えば、秘密鍵がなければ新しいアドレスを生成することもできません。

したがって、アドレスの「変更」=秘密鍵の「再生成」という理解が必要です。しかし、秘密鍵の再生成は、元の鍵を失った場合にのみ行われる操作であり、それは「新しいウォレットの作成」と同じ意味になります。

3. セキュリティ上のリスク回避

仮にアドレス変更機能が存在した場合、ユーザーが誤ってアドレスを変更した際、そのアドレスに紐づくすべての資産が失われる可能性があります。また、悪意ある第三者が「アドレス変更」を要求するフィッシング攻撃の口実になることも考えられます。このようなリスクを防ぐために、メタマスク開発チームは、アドレス変更の機能を設計段階から排除しています。

実際にアドレスを「変更」したい場合の正しい対処法

アドレス変更ができないとしても、ユーザーが「新しいアドレスを使いたい」「古いアドレスに問題がある」と感じた場合は、いくつかの代替手段があります。以下の手順は、正しく、安全に進めるためのガイドラインです。

1. 新しいウォレットを作成する

最も確実かつ推奨される方法は、新しいMetaMaskウォレットを作成することです。これにより、完全に新しいアドレスが生成され、これまでの取引履歴や資産との関連が切断されます。

  • MetaMaskの拡張機能を開き、右上にある「プロフィールアイコン」をクリック。
  • 「ウォレットの切り替え」または「新しいウォレットを作成」を選択。
  • 新しいウォレットの設定が開始され、12語のバックアップパスフレーズ(シードノート)が表示される。
  • このパスフレーズは、永久に保管し、決して共有しないことが必須です。

新規ウォレットの作成後、以前のアドレスに残っている資産を移動する必要があります。これは次のステップで詳しく説明します。

2. 資産の移転:古いアドレスから新しいアドレスへ

旧アドレスに残っている資産(イーサリアム、ERC-20トークン、NFTなど)を新しいアドレスに移すには、通常の送金操作を行います。ただし、以下の点に注意が必要です。

  • 送金手数料(ガス代)が発生します。手数料はネットワークの混雑状況によって変動しますので、事前に確認しましょう。
  • 送金先のアドレスは、正確にコピーしてください。誤送金は取り消しが不可能です。
  • 必要に応じて、スマートコントラクトやDApp(分散型アプリ)の設定を更新する必要があります。

このプロセスは、あくまで「資産の移動」であり、「アドレスの変更」ではありません。アドレス自体は不変ですが、資産の所有主体を新しいアドレスに切り替えることができます。

3. 旧アドレスの使用を停止する

新しいアドレスにすべての資産を移し終えた後、旧アドレスは使用を停止することが推奨されます。これは、セキュリティ強化の観点から重要です。旧アドレスが何らかの形で漏洩していた場合、新たなリスクを避けるためです。

なお、旧アドレスに残っているゼロの残高は、そのままブロックチェーン上に記録され続けます。これは、ブロックチェーンの透明性と不可逆性の証です。無関係な情報が残っていても、問題はありません。

よくある誤解と注意点

MetaMaskのアドレス変更について、以下のような誤解がよく見られます。これらを正しく理解することで、より安全な運用が可能になります。

誤解1:「アドレス名を変えたい」→ 名前ではなくアドレス

MetaMaskでは、アドレスに「ニックネーム」を設定できます(例:「メインウォレット」など)。これは、ユーザーフレンドリーな表示のためのものであり、アドレス自体の変更ではありません。このニックネームは、他のウォレットやDAppと連携する際にも影響しません。

誤解2:「別のウォレットにアドレスを移すことができる」

アドレスそのものを「移す」ことはできません。移せるのは、そのアドレスに紐づく資産だけです。アドレスはブロックチェーン上の論理的な存在であり、物理的な住所のように「引っ越し」はできません。

誤解3:「アドレスを変更すれば、取引履歴が消える」

アドレスの変更(=新しいウォレットの作成)を行っても、過去の取引履歴はブロックチェーン上に永遠に残ります。これは、透明性の原則に基づくものです。すべての取引は検証可能であり、誰でも閲覧可能です。

まとめ:アドレス変更の現実と代替案

結論として、MetaMaskのアドレス変更は技術的にも制度的にも不可能です。これは、ブロックチェーン技術の基本原理、セキュリティ設計、およびネットワークの信頼性を守るための必然的な措置です。アドレスは、秘密鍵から生成された唯一無二の識別子であり、再生成・再割り当ては許されません。

しかし、ユーザーが「新しいアドレスを使いたい」「既存のアドレスに不安を感じている」といったニーズがある場合、適切な対処法は存在します。それは、新しいウォレットを作成し、資産を移転するというプロセスです。これにより、アドレスの「切り替え」は達成できます。

最終的に、ユーザー自身が資産の所有権と秘密鍵の管理責任を負うという点を忘れてはなりません。アドレスの変更ができないという事実は、むしろ「資産の安全性を守るための保護装置」とも言えます。正しく理解し、慎重に行動することで、安心かつ効率的なブロックチェーン利用が可能になります。

【要約】
MetaMaskのアドレス変更は、技術的・制度的に不可能です。アドレスは秘密鍵から生成され、ブロックチェーンの不可逆性により、変更・再生成はできません。ただし、新しいウォレットを作成し、資産を移転することで、実質的な「アドレスの切り替え」は実現可能です。重要なのは、資産の安全な管理と、誤解を避けるための知識の習得です。正しく理解し、慎重に運用することが、ブロックチェーン時代における成功の鍵となります。


前の記事

MetaMask(メタマスク)の利用で日本語サポートを受ける方法は?

次の記事

MetaMask(メタマスク)での日本円入金は可能?安全な方法まとめ

コメントを書く

Leave a Com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です